Questions
How much do Camera Operators, Television, Video, and Film make in Texas?

The median Camera Operators, Television, Video, and Film in Texas earns $63,110 per year (BLS May 2025), about $30.34 per hour.

What is that after taxes?

$63,110 gross in Texas keeps $52,889 after federal income tax ($5,393), FICA ($4,828) and state income tax ($0) — $4,407 per month, a 83.8% keep-rate.

How does Texas compare to the national median for Camera Operators, Television, Video, and Film?

The Texas median is $11,880 below the national median of $74,990.

Which state pays Camera Operators, Television, Video, and Film the most?

California has the highest median gross for Camera Operators, Television, Video, and Film at $106,900 — but compare take-home, not gross: state taxes change the order.
